Deadly Christmas: 33 Lives Lost In Prison Riot

A violent riot at a maximum-security prison in Maputo, Mozambique, claimed the lives of 33 people and left 15 others injured on Christmas Day, authorities confirmed.

The unrest reportedly began within the prison walls and escalated, with conflicting accounts over its cause. While Police General Commander Bernadino Rafael attributed the riot to external protests near the prison, Justice Minister Helena Kida dismissed this claim, stating the disturbance started inside the facility.

During the chaos, approximately 1,530 inmates escaped, with only 150 recaptured so far.

The incident occurs amid growing civil unrest in the country, linked to October’s disputed elections.

Details about the identities of those killed and injured remain unclear as authorities continue their investigation.
